Xander Cage, a. k. a. xXx, is a law-breaking extreme sports enthusiast, with a propensity for rebellious behavior. After crashing a senator's Corvette for banning extreme sports, he is given a choice by US Government agent Augustus Gibbons- work for him or serve a prison term for his misdeeds. He grudgingly chooses government employment. He is to go undercover in order to find out more about a rebellious underground group 'Anarchy 99' and in particular their leader 'Yorgi', a Russian ex-soldier who has a grudge against society and authority. Delving into the dark underworld inhabited by the group, Xander finds himself drawn to Yorgi's apparent girlfriend Yelena, who turns out to be an abandoned agent of a Russian intelligence agency, the FSB, and he negotiates an asylum deal with Gibbons to save, and secure her a new life in America. However, Anarchy 99 turns out to be a terrorist faction, planning a series of chemical weapons attacks on major world cities by utilizing a high speed automated sea-faring drone, named Ahab. Xander, with Yelena continuing to act as a double agent, learns that Ahab is equipped with a device designed to travel to highly populated areas where it can deploy its biological missiles and continue on its world-ending journey by submerging in the ocean. Then, Xander arranges an operation to raid the remote castle which Yorgi and Anarchy 99 have been using as their base and laboratory. After Xander shoots and kills Yorgi, Xander speeds along winding roads, and parasails onto Ahab, as it speeds down a river towards Prague, finally destroying the drone and the chemicals onboard. Harry L. O'Connor, Diesel's stunt double, was killed in an accident during filming, in a scene in which he was supposed to rappel down a parasailing line and land on a submarine. The short film ties up the loose ends from the first film and ties into the beginning of the sequel — albeit not very neatly. A special ops team, wearing identical uniforms to the special ops team in the sequel's opening scene, track down Xander Cage, who happens to be on a date with Jordan King. The team tricks Cage into entering a building they have rigged to explode. Cage, being the hero, enters the building in the hopes of rescuing his date. Cage meets his demise, after which Lt. Cobb arrives on the scene to verify Cage's death.
